The purpose of this research is to gather information on the safety and effectiveness of using an imaging technique called magnetic resonance imaging (MRI) to decrease radiation dose to the uninvolved prostate (areas of the prostate that do not clearly have cancer cells) while increasing radiation dose to the nodules (hardened areas of the prostate that have cancer cells).

Radiation to the prostate gland will be given daily (Mon-Friday) for 4 weeks.
The study doctor will use an MRI scan to take pictures of the prostate gland. These images of the prostate gland will let the study doctor know which areas of the prostate contain cancer cells that need to be targeted with higher doses of radiation and which uninvolved areas to target with lower doses of radiation.
Treatment of treating physician choice will be given for 6-24 months.
Time frame: 12 months after treatment
Decrease by at least 5 points in bowel related endpoints as measured by Expanded Prostate Cancer Index Composite 26 (EPIC-26) questionnaire.
Time frame: 2 year after start of treatment
Number of participants that have failed ADT therapy after 2 years as shown by prostate specific antigen (PSA) levels..
Time frame: 12 months post treatment
Correlation between signs of cancer as seen by imaging and tissue (pathology)
Time frame: 12 months post treatment
Number of gastrointestinal, genitourinary, and sexual side effects that are grade 2 or above per the Common Terminology Criteria for Adverse Events (CTCAE)
Time frame: 12 months post treatment
Improvement in patient reported quality of life (shown higher scores of worse symptoms) with the scale values assigned to each question ranging from 0 (best) to 4 (worst) of gastrointestinal, genitourinary, and sexual function as assess by Expanded Prostate Cancer Index (EPIC) questionnaires
